It's the annual Salute to Service game – we'll honor those who served in all military branches!

Pregame:
Get to your seats early to see the United States-shaped flag takeover the field as we honor those who serve or have served in all military branches!

NFL Clear Bag Policy:
Bags and purses will not be allowed in the stadium due to the NFL's Clear Bag Policy. So, be sure to bring a clear bag, a clutch purse no bigger than your hand or pocket what you need this Sunday. See Full Details>>>
